Israeli missiles strike targets in Syria’s Hama province: SANA | Syria’s War News

Syria claims Israeli jets carried out assaults in central province, including its army shot down many of the missiles.

Syrian state media claims Israeli warplanes fired a number of missiles in central Syria area of Hama early on Friday, including that its air defence forces downed many of the missiles. It, nevertheless, didn’t give phrase on any casualties.

The state-run SANA information company quoted an unnamed army official as saying Friday’s assault happened shortly earlier than daybreak when Israeli warplanes flew over neighbouring Lebanon.

“At about 4 o’clock [02;00 GMT] within the morning in the present day, the Israeli enemy launched an aerial aggression with a barrage of missiles coming from the path of the Lebanese metropolis of Tripoli, aiming at some targets within the neighborhood of Hama governorate. Our air defences confronted the enemy’s missiles and downed most of them,” the report quoted a army supply as saying.

Israel has launched lots of of raids towards what it calls Iran-linked army targets in Syria through the years however not often acknowledges or discusses such operations. Iran and its Lebanese ally Hezbollah have backed Syrian President Bashar al-Assad within the civil battle by supplying army provides and fighters.

Friday’s assault was Israel’s first assault on Syria since US President Joe Biden took workplace. Israel has justified the assaults inside Syria, claiming Iran and Hezbollah pose a safety threat.

On January 13, Israeli warplanes carried out intense air assaults in jap Syria apparently hitting positions and arms depots of Iran-backed forces, killing no less than 57 fighters and wounding dozens – the worst assault in years.

The Syrian Observatory for Human Rights, an opposition battle monitor that tracks Syria’s battle, mentioned it recorded 39 Israeli assaults inside Syria in 2020 that hit 135 targets, together with army posts, warehouses or automobiles.

The raids additionally come amid intensifying low-altitude Israeli warplane missions in Lebanese skies which have brought about jitters amongst residents.
